What Is an Interactive Flat Panel?

An Interactive Flat Panel is a large touchscreen display that works like a digital whiteboard combined with a computer and projector — minus the mess and maintenance. Teachers and trainers can write with a stylus or finger, show videos, run apps, browse the internet, and save notes instantly.

Instead of standing with their back to learners, educators now face them, interact with content in real time, and turn lessons into conversations rather than lectures.

Bringing Lessons to Life in Classrooms

One of the biggest problems in traditional classrooms has always been passive learning. Students listen, copy notes, and forget. Interactive Flat Panels change that rhythm.

With touch-based interaction, teachers can:

  • Draw diagrams and move objects on screen

  • Zoom into maps, science models, and math problems

  • Play educational videos and pause them to explain

  • Invite students to solve problems directly on the screen

Suddenly, learning feels participative. A biology lesson can turn into a 3D tour of the human heart. A history class can explore real maps and timelines. Even math becomes visual instead of abstract.

“Students remember what they touch and explore, not just what they hear.”

This is why Interactive Flat Panels in education are becoming central to smart classrooms worldwide.

Smarter Training for Modern Workplaces

The transformation is just as visible in corporate training rooms. Trainers no longer rely only on slides. With Interactive Flat Panels, sessions become collaborative workshops instead of one-way presentations.

Trainers can:

  • Annotate directly on reports and charts

  • Brainstorm with teams using digital whiteboards

  • Connect remote participants through video tools

  • Save session notes and share them instantly

For onboarding, skill training, or strategy meetings, the panel becomes a shared workspace. Everyone sees the same screen, edits the same ideas, and stays focused.

This is especially powerful for hybrid training environments, where some learners are in the room and others are online. The panel bridges that gap naturally.

Easy for Teachers and Trainers to Use

Technology only works if people actually use it. One reason Interactive Flat Panels are spreading fast is their simplicity.

Most panels offer:

  • Built-in whiteboard apps

  • Wireless screen sharing

  • One-touch access to files and tools

  • Simple saving and exporting of notes

Teachers don’t need to be tech experts. Trainers don’t need complicated setups. They turn the panel on and start teaching.

Over time, many educators say the panel feels less like a gadget and more like a natural teaching tool — just smarter.

Supporting Digital and Hybrid Learning

Education and training are no longer tied to one physical space. Online classes, recorded sessions, and blended learning models are now normal.

Interactive Flat Panels support this shift by:

  • Recording lessons and annotations

  • Integrating with learning platforms

  • Allowing live collaboration with remote learners

  • Sharing content instantly after class

This means learning doesn’t stop when the session ends. Students can revisit lessons. Trainees can review key points. Knowledge becomes reusable instead of disappearing with erased chalk.

A Cost-Effective Long-Term Solution

While the initial investment may seem high, Interactive Flat Panels often replace multiple tools: projector, whiteboard, speakers, and sometimes even a computer.

They:

  • Reduce maintenance costs

  • Eliminate projector bulbs and alignment issues

  • Last longer than traditional setups

  • Save time in daily teaching routines

For institutions and companies thinking long-term, this makes financial sense as well as educational sense.
